Added any_talisman item

This commit is contained in:
Auxilor
2021-10-05 20:22:26 +01:00
parent 0b0f80ce1d
commit 5eb98fda3a
3 changed files with 5 additions and 2 deletions

View File

@@ -46,7 +46,7 @@ allprojects {
} }
dependencies { dependencies {
compileOnly 'com.willfp:eco:6.8.1' compileOnly 'com.willfp:eco:6.9.0'
compileOnly 'org.jetbrains:annotations:19.0.0' compileOnly 'org.jetbrains:annotations:19.0.0'

View File

@@ -3,11 +3,13 @@ package com.willfp.talismans;
import com.willfp.eco.core.EcoPlugin; import com.willfp.eco.core.EcoPlugin;
import com.willfp.eco.core.command.impl.PluginCommand; import com.willfp.eco.core.command.impl.PluginCommand;
import com.willfp.eco.core.display.DisplayModule; import com.willfp.eco.core.display.DisplayModule;
import com.willfp.eco.core.items.CustomItem;
import com.willfp.talismans.command.CommandTalismans; import com.willfp.talismans.command.CommandTalismans;
import com.willfp.talismans.display.TalismanDisplay; import com.willfp.talismans.display.TalismanDisplay;
import com.willfp.talismans.talismans.Talismans; import com.willfp.talismans.talismans.Talismans;
import com.willfp.talismans.talismans.util.BlockPlaceListener; import com.willfp.talismans.talismans.util.BlockPlaceListener;
import com.willfp.talismans.talismans.util.DiscoverRecipeListener; import com.willfp.talismans.talismans.util.DiscoverRecipeListener;
import com.willfp.talismans.talismans.util.TalismanChecks;
import com.willfp.talismans.talismans.util.TalismanCraftListener; import com.willfp.talismans.talismans.util.TalismanCraftListener;
import com.willfp.talismans.talismans.util.WatcherTriggers; import com.willfp.talismans.talismans.util.WatcherTriggers;
import com.willfp.talismans.talismans.util.equipevent.SyncTalismanEquipEventTask; import com.willfp.talismans.talismans.util.equipevent.SyncTalismanEquipEventTask;
@@ -39,6 +41,7 @@ public class TalismansPlugin extends EcoPlugin {
@Override @Override
protected void handleEnable() { protected void handleEnable() {
this.getLogger().info(Talismans.values().size() + " Talismans Loaded"); this.getLogger().info(Talismans.values().size() + " Talismans Loaded");
new CustomItem(this.getNamespacedKeyFactory().create("any_talisman"), test -> TalismanChecks.getTalismanOnItem(test) != null, Talismans.SHARPNESS_TALISMAN.getLevel(1).getItemStack()).register();
} }
@Override @Override

View File

@@ -1,2 +1,2 @@
version = 4.6.0 version = 4.6.1
plugin-name = Talismans plugin-name = Talismans